在CentOS系統中管理LibOffice插件可以通過以下幾種方法進行:
使用YUM倉庫安裝
更新系統包列表:
sudo yum update -y
安裝LibOffice及其插件:
sudo yum install libreoffice libreoffice-plugins -y
安裝特定插件:
sudo yum install libreoffice-<plugin-name> -y
例如,安裝“Math”插件:
sudo yum install libreoffice-math -y
手動下載并安裝插件
訪問LibOffice官方插件庫或其他可信的第三方插件網站,找到你需要的插件。
下載插件的.oxt文件到你的CentOS系統上。
打開終端,導航到下載目錄,然后運行以下命令來安裝插件:
sudo libreoffice --install-extension /path/to/plugin.oxt
將 /path/to/plugin.oxt 替換為你下載的插件文件的實際路徑。
使用Snap包管理器(適用于CentOS 8及以上版本)
啟用Snap倉庫:
sudo dnf install snapd -y
sudo systemctl enable --now snapd.socket
sudo ln -s /var/lib/snapd/snap /snap
安裝LibOffice Snap包:
sudo snap install libreoffice --classic
使用Snap命令安裝插件:
sudo snap connect libreoffice:home :home
sudo snap refresh libreoffice
然后按照手動安裝插件的步驟進行。
使用YUM命令
卸載LibOffice及其相關組件:
sudo yum remove libreoffice libreoffice-client libreoffice-common libreoffice-core libreoffice-gnome libreoffice-gtk libreoffice-writer libreoffice-calc libreoffice-impress libreoffice-draw libreoffice-base libreoffice-en-us libreoffice-help-en-us
清理殘留文件(可選):
sudo yum autoremove
手動刪除
查找LibOffice安裝目錄:
rpm -ql libreoffice | grep /usr/lib
rpm -ql libreoffice | grep /usr/share
rpm -ql libreoffice | grep /etc
刪除相關文件和目錄:
sudo rm -rf /usr/lib/libreoffice*
sudo rm -rf /usr/share/libreoffice*
sudo rm -rf /etc/libreoffice*
刪除用戶配置文件(如果有):
rm -rf ~/.config/libreoffice*
使用YUM包管理器
更新系統:
sudo yum update
檢查LibOffice是否有更新可用:
sudo yum check-update libreoffice
進行系統更新:
sudo yum update libreoffice
重啟操作系統:
sudo reboot
使用Flatpak或Snap方式更新
安裝Flatpak支持:
sudo yum install -y flatpak
fl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o
flatpak install flathub org.libreoffice/libreoffice
安裝Snap支持:
sudo snap install libreoffice --classic
通過以上方法,你應該能夠在CentOS上成功安裝、卸載、更新和管理LibOffice插件。